| Title: | New Forms Of Brownian Motion (Colloquia) |
|---|---|
| Start Date: | 09/19/2005 |
| Time: | 4:30 pm |
| Location: | 1 LeConte Hall |
| Speaker: | Dr. Pierre-Gilles De Gennes |
| Affiliation: | Professor Emeritus, College de France, Institut Curie, Nobel Laureate (1991) |
| Contact Person: | K. Lee (510) 642-3034 |
| Details: | A coin (or a droplet) on a solid plate drifts when the plate is vibrated (horizontally) unsymmetrical. If the vibrations are a white noise, we find a new type of Brownian motion with dry friction. |
